1 | AT_BANNER([MoleCuilder - Analysis])
|
---|
2 | # 1. pair correlation analysis
|
---|
3 | AT_SETUP([Analysis - pair correlation])
|
---|
4 | AT_KEYWORDS([analysis])
|
---|
5 | AT_CHECK([/bin/cp -f ${abs_top_srcdir}/${AUTOTEST_PATH}/Analysis/1/pre/test.conf .], 0)
|
---|
6 | AT_CHECK([../../molecuilder test.conf -e ${abs_top_srcdir}/src/ -v 3 -C E 1 8 output.csv bin_output.csv 0 20], 0, [stdout], [stderr])
|
---|
7 | AT_CHECK([fgrep "Begin of PairCorrelation" stdout], 0, [ignore], [ignore])
|
---|
8 | AT_CHECK([file=output.csv; diff $file ${abs_top_srcdir}/${AUTOTEST_PATH}/Analysis/1/post/$file], 0, [ignore], [ignore])
|
---|
9 | AT_CHECK([file=bin_output.csv; diff $file ${abs_top_srcdir}/${AUTOTEST_PATH}/Analysis/1/post/$file], 0, [ignore], [ignore])
|
---|
10 | AT_CLEANUP
|
---|
11 |
|
---|
12 | # 2. pair correlation analysis - range test
|
---|
13 | AT_SETUP([Analysis - pair correlation range test])
|
---|
14 | AT_KEYWORDS([analysis])
|
---|
15 | AT_CHECK([/bin/cp -f ${abs_top_srcdir}/${AUTOTEST_PATH}/Analysis/2/pre/test.conf .], 0)
|
---|
16 | AT_CHECK([../../molecuilder test.conf -e ${abs_top_srcdir}/src/ -v 3 -C E 1 8 output-5.csv bin_output-5.csv 0 5], 0, [stdout], [stderr])
|
---|
17 | AT_CHECK([file=output-5.csv; diff $file ${abs_top_srcdir}/${AUTOTEST_PATH}/Analysis/2/post/$file], 0, [ignore], [ignore])
|
---|
18 | AT_CHECK([file=bin_output-5.csv; diff $file ${abs_top_srcdir}/${AUTOTEST_PATH}/Analysis/2/post/$file], 0, [ignore], [ignore])
|
---|
19 | AT_CHECK([../../molecuilder test.conf -e ${abs_top_srcdir}/src/ -v 3 -C E 1 8 output-10.csv bin_output-10.csv 5 10], 0, [stdout], [stderr])
|
---|
20 | AT_CHECK([file=output-10.csv; diff $file ${abs_top_srcdir}/${AUTOTEST_PATH}/Analysis/2/post/$file], 0, [ignore], [ignore])
|
---|
21 | AT_CHECK([file=bin_output-10.csv; diff $file ${abs_top_srcdir}/${AUTOTEST_PATH}/Analysis/2/post/$file], 0, [ignore], [ignore])
|
---|
22 | AT_CHECK([../../molecuilder test.conf -e ${abs_top_srcdir}/src/ -v 3 -C E 1 8 output-20.csv bin_output-20.csv 10 20], 0, [stdout], [stderr])
|
---|
23 | AT_CHECK([file=output-20.csv; diff $file ${abs_top_srcdir}/${AUTOTEST_PATH}/Analysis/2/post/$file], 0, [ignore], [ignore])
|
---|
24 | AT_CHECK([file=bin_output-20.csv; diff $file ${abs_top_srcdir}/${AUTOTEST_PATH}/Analysis/2/post/$file], 0, [ignore], [ignore])
|
---|
25 | AT_CLEANUP
|
---|
26 |
|
---|
27 | # 3. pair correlation analysis to point
|
---|
28 | AT_SETUP([Analysis - point correlation])
|
---|
29 | AT_KEYWORDS([analysis])
|
---|
30 | AT_CHECK([/bin/cp -f ${abs_top_srcdir}/${AUTOTEST_PATH}/Analysis/3/pre/test.conf .], 0)
|
---|
31 | AT_CHECK([../../molecuilder test.conf -e ${abs_top_srcdir}/src/ -v 3 -C P 1 10. 10. 10. output.csv bin_output.csv 0 20], 0, [stdout], [stderr])
|
---|
32 | AT_CHECK([fgrep "Begin of CorrelationToPoint" stdout], 0, [ignore], [ignore])
|
---|
33 | AT_CHECK([file=output.csv; diff $file ${abs_top_srcdir}/${AUTOTEST_PATH}/Analysis/3/post/$file], 0, [ignore], [ignore])
|
---|
34 | AT_CHECK([file=bin_output.csv; diff $file ${abs_top_srcdir}/${AUTOTEST_PATH}/Analysis/3/post/$file], 0, [ignore], [ignore])
|
---|
35 | AT_CLEANUP
|
---|
36 |
|
---|
37 | # 4. pair correlation analysis to surface
|
---|
38 | AT_SETUP([Analysis - surface correlation])
|
---|
39 | AT_KEYWORDS([analysis])
|
---|
40 | AT_CHECK([/bin/cp -f ${abs_top_srcdir}/${AUTOTEST_PATH}/Analysis/4/pre/test.conf .], 0)
|
---|
41 | AT_CHECK([../../molecuilder test.conf -e ${abs_top_srcdir}/src/ -v 3 -I -C S 1 output.csv bin_output.csv 1. 0 20], 0, [stdout], [stderr])
|
---|
42 | AT_CHECK([fgrep "Begin of CorrelationToSurface" stdout], 0, [ignore], [ignore])
|
---|
43 | AT_CHECK([file=output.csv; diff $file ${abs_top_srcdir}/${AUTOTEST_PATH}/Analysis/4/post/$file], 0, [ignore], [ignore])
|
---|
44 | AT_CHECK([file=bin_output.csv; diff $file ${abs_top_srcdir}/${AUTOTEST_PATH}/Analysis/4/post/$file], 0, [ignore], [ignore])
|
---|
45 | AT_CLEANUP
|
---|
46 |
|
---|
47 | # 4. principal axis system
|
---|
48 | AT_SETUP([Analysis - principal axis system])
|
---|
49 | AT_KEYWORDS([analysis])
|
---|
50 | AT_CHECK([/bin/cp -f ${abs_top_srcdir}/${AUTOTEST_PATH}/Analysis/5/pre/test.conf .], 0)
|
---|
51 | AT_CHECK([../../molecuilder test.conf -e ${abs_top_srcdir}/src/ -v 3 -m 0], 0, [stdout], [stderr])
|
---|
52 | AT_CHECK([fgrep "eigenvalue = 4382.53," stdout], 0, [ignore], [ignore])
|
---|
53 | AT_CHECK([fgrep "eigenvalue = 4369.24," stdout], 0, [ignore], [ignore])
|
---|
54 | AT_CHECK([fgrep "eigenvalue = 28.9359," stdout], 0, [ignore], [ignore])
|
---|
55 | AT_CLEANUP
|
---|